- The distance between Sidi Ifni, Morocco and Hassakah, Syria is approximately 4,764 km or 2,960 mi.
- To reach Sidi Ifni in this distance one would set out from Hassakah bearing 275.7°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ach Sidi Ifni bearing 246.6° or WSW .
- Sidi Ifni has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Hassakah has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- Sidi Ifni is in or near the subtropical desert scrub biome whereas Hassakah is in or near the subtropical thorn woodland biome.
- The annual average temperature is 0.8 °C (1.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 19.8 °C (35.6°F) less in Sidi Ifni.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 136.9 mm (5.4 in) less which is equivalent to 136.9 l/m² (3.36 US gal/ft²) or 1,369,000 l/ha (146,355 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7.1° higher in Sidi Ifni than in Hassakah.
